How it works
The operation of CoralGuard technology is divided into three layers: 1. Dynamic perception layer: Satellite and ROV cruise data are fused to generate a "coral planet map", and the red/orange/green color blocks are used to mark the bleaching rate of diseased reefs in real time; 2. Ecological intervention layer: soundscape guidance plays the sound field of the healthy reef through the underwater speaker array to attract juvenile fish to return to the nest, and at the same time, pheromone capsules are deployed, and degradable sustained-release capsules are used to accurately deliver them, and coral-ketone-like substances are released to guide the clean fish to snipe at diseases; 3. Crowdfunding driving layer: Users receive the location of the reef through the App, trigger the virtual task of "sonic transmission" or "capsule delivery" (the completion is linked to the physical device),
Design process
The evolution of the technology is as follows: in the conceptual stage, based on the pain point of high cost of artificial transplantation of coral restoration ($1.2 million/ha), the principle of "natural self-healing priority" is proposed, and the dual-core intervention path of soundscape guidance (juvenile homing) and pheromone (clean fish) is established; The prototype V1 includes a perception layer (buoy sonar satellite data to generate a static reef map with an accuracy of ± 100m), a soundscape module (a single speaker plays a broadband sound field, and the response rate of juveniles is only 35%), and a capsule (the PLA shell is manually delivered, and it takes 30 days to degrade); Key iterations include: 1. Dynamic map upgrade, integrating ROV cruise image and AI whitening recognition algorithm, and improving accuracy to ±5m (red/orange/green real-time color block); 2. Breakthrough in the soundscape system, using phased array speakers, the response rate soared to 83% (measured on the Great Barrier Reef); 3. Capsule optimization, calcium alginate sustained-release carrier, 48-hour degradation and targeted release; 4.App lightweight, gamified tasks are bound to physical device commands (the user clicks → the sonic emission delay is < 2 seconds).
